About Long Beach Catholic Regional School

Long Beach Catholic Regional School is a private elementary school in Long Beach, NY. Long Beach Catholic Regional School serves approximately 255 students, and covers grades Pre-K-8th, and has a 11.4:1 student-teacher ratio. Long Beach Catholic Regional School has a current MySchoolScout rating of 5.9 out of 10 and ranks #625 of 992 private schools in NY.

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about Long Beach Catholic Regional School

What grades does Long Beach Catholic Regional School serve?

Long Beach Catholic Regional School serves students in grades Pre-K through 8th.

How many students attend Long Beach Catholic Regional School?

Long Beach Catholic Regional School has an enrollment of approximately 255 students.

What is the student-teacher ratio at Long Beach Catholic Regional School?

The student-teacher ratio at Long Beach Catholic Regional School is 11.4:1. A lower ratio generally means more individual attention per student. The national average is approximately 11:1 for private schools.

How does Long Beach Catholic Regional School rank in NY?

Long Beach Catholic Regional School ranks #625 of 992 private schools in NY.

What is Long Beach Catholic Regional School's MySchoolScout rating?

Long Beach Catholic Regional School has a current MySchoolScout rating of 5.9 out of 10. This score combines the level-appropriate components shown in the rating breakdown; equity data is shown separately for context.

Is Long Beach Catholic Regional School a private school?

Yes, Long Beach Catholic Regional School is a private coeducational school with a Roman Catholic affiliation. Private schools are not required to participate in state standardized testing, so academic performance data may be limited compared to public schools.

Is Long Beach Catholic Regional School a religious school?

Long Beach Catholic Regional School has a Roman Catholic religious affiliation.
